General Information about #1E1E29 (Mirage)

The hex color #1E1E29, also known as Mirage, is a dark, muted shade that resides in the realm of deep grays and blacks. It is composed of 11.8% red, 11.8% green, and 16.1% blue. In the RGB color model, it has values of 30 red, 30 green, and 41 blue. It is often perceived as a sophisticated and neutral color, making it a popular choice in design applications where a subtle, understated backdrop is desired. Its hex triplet is #1E1E29, and it falls within the dark range, suitable for creating contrast or a calming atmosphere. This color evokes a sense of elegance and can be readily incorporated into various design schemes.

The color #1E1E29, also known as Mirage, presents some accessibility challenges, especially regarding text contrast. When using this color as a background, it is crucial to select foreground text colors that offer sufficient contrast to ensure readability for users with visual impairments. According to WCAG guidelines, a cont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for normal text and 3:1 for large text. Light shades of gray, white, or other pale hues would generally work better as foreground colors against the dark background of #1E1E29. Tools like contrast checkers can assist in determining if chosen color combinations meet accessibility standards. Furthermore, providing alternative text descriptions for images and other non-text content is also vital to ensuring inclusive design practices when using this color.
